Wondering if anyone out there happens to know if a 1970's (non-master volume) Dual Showman Reverb head would fit into an early 1980's Pro Reverb cabnet. I know that the DSR head will fit into a 1970's or early 80's Twin Reverb cabnet but according to the Fender Amp Field Guide the Pro Reverb cabnet is 19.5" x 26" x 10.5" and the Twin is 20" x 26 x 10.5". Ray-I had a blackface Twin chassis in a silverface Pro Reverb cab for a while...if the Dual Showman chassis is the same size as a Twin,it should fit...
